CEICO welcomes applications for several Postdoctoral Researcher positions in any area of string theory.
The duration of these posts is up to three years, starting in September 2017 (initial contract for 2 years, renewable for a further year subject to performance).
Successful candidates are expected to have, or be working towards, a doctoral degree in Physics or a related field, and work in string theory or related areas of theoretical physics such as gauge theory, conformal field theory, higher spin theory etc.
The application:
Applicants are requested to apply by clicking the button below, filling the online form and uploading a single pdf file (font size no less than 11) containing
- Curriculum Vitae.
- List of publications.
- A one-page statement of past research achievements.
- A one-page research proposal, describing also how their research interests would fit within CEICO.
The contact details of at least three academic referees must be supplied online. As the application system will contact the referees automatically, it is the applicant’s responsibility to inform them of their application and the deadline.
The deadline for all application material (including reference letters) is 15 February 2017.
